Long Wave Inc. is a veteran-owned defense contractor built around Very Low Frequency (VLF) communications expertise for the U.S. Navy, now expanding into broader military communications and IT infrastructure. The tech stack reveals a hybrid profile: enterprise infrastructure (Active Directory, SAP, Deltek Costpoint) paired with specialized defense tools (S1000D, Arbortext) and creative/simulation software (Unity, Adobe suite, Articulate Storyline), suggesting a delivery model that spans system design, training content, and operational support. Hiring is accelerating across design and ops—consistent with active projects in enterprise migration, NC3 systems, and interactive technical manuals.

About Long Wave Inc.

Long Wave Inc. provides communications engineering, system integration, and professional services to the U.S. military since 1995. The company specializes in communications analysis and engineering, antenna and tower installation/repair, site operations, training and simulation, and IT solutions. As a government contractor, Long Wave serves mission-critical defense programs including NC3 (command and control) and HF communications systems. The organization is staffed with senior engineers and retired military personnel, operating with a 51–200 employee base. Current project focus includes enterprise application migrations, new system implementations, and expanding footprint across the military communications portfolio.
